Responsibilities & Context: Ensure paste making and block/screen print process according to approved samples and maintain product quality. Prepare screen frames, ensure proper chemical mixing, and supervise the screen and block printing process with accuracy and standard compliance.
Responsibilities:
- Receive color and chemical materials from logistics, checking for stability and density.
- Receive blocks according to approved design and size.
- Maintain stock of color and other chemicals in an organized manner.
- Mix colors and chemicals based on approved swatch samples.
- Solve color-related issues during production.
- Inspect product quality throughout the production process.
- Maintain records of color measurement, costing, and daily usage in control forms.
- Train new workers on block and screen-printing techniques.
- Develop screen frames in the darkroom as per job order/design, ensuring quality.
- Coordinate closely with designers to meet design expectations.
- Collect and manage production materials related to block and screen print.
- Mix colors for both block and screen printing.
- Safely preserve screen frames and printing tools.
